Like vitamins C and E, there are also certain minerals that have been shown to be especially useful in regulating estrogen levels. These include magnesium and calcium.

Magnesium has been shown to significantly mitigate PMS symptoms, including mood changes, pain, inflammation, and breast cysts. Calcium is also quite successful at alleviating PMS-related symptoms.

If suffer from estrogen dominance or symptoms of excess estrogen, such as PMS or mood swings, Dr. Lark recommends taking 600–750 mg of magnesium with 50–100 of vitamin B6, as well as 1,200–1,500 mg of calcium carbonate each day.
